CNC Miller and Turner (Extensive Overtime)

Exeter

Up to £23ph (OTE up to £68,000) + Extensive optional Overtime + Benefits + Early Finish on a Friday

Are you a CNC Miller or Turner with experience working on CNC milling machines and CNC lathes, looking to join a well-established engineering company where you will predominantly be working on one-off products so no one day is the same?

Do you want to join an established engineering business that invests in its people, offering long-term stability, extensive overtime opportunities and the opportunity to work on high-quality precision-machined components for a range of demanding industries including Civil Engineering, Construction and Industrial Processing?

On offer is a fantastic opportunity to become part of an established precision engineering business, where you will program, set and operate CNC milling machines and CNC lathes to manufacture a variety of components to exact specifications, working with a range of metals and engineering materials.

This role would suit a CNC Miller, CNC Turner, CNC Machinist or similar with experience operating CNC milling machines and/or CNC lathes and looking for a varied position where you can work on both one-off and production components within a well-equipped engineering workshop.

In this role, the successful CNC Miller & Turner or similar will:

  • Program, set and operate CNC machinery
  • Interpret engineering drawings
  • Carry out dimensional inspections
  • Manufacture precision components to demanding tolerances while maintaining high standards of quality and safety

The Role:

  • Setting and operating CNC milling machines and CNC lathes to manufacture precision components
  • Monday to Thursday 7:00 till 16:00 and 7:00 till 13:00 on Fridays
  • Overtime paid at 1.5 x, up to 15 optional hours available per week

The Person:

  • CNC Miller, CNC Turner, CNC Machinist or similar background within programming
  • Experience working within a precision engineering or heavy engineering environment
  • Ability to work on both one-off/bespoke components and production runs would be advantageous
